Next to the chicken, the egg noodles are my favorite part. Don’t put them in until right at the end and turn the heat off when they are just starting to get soft to prevent them from getting mushy.

Chicken Noodle Soup

PREP: 10 minutes
COOK: 28 minutes
TOTAL: 38 minutes
SERVINGS: 8 servings

Ingredients

  • 3 tablespoons butter
  • 1 medium sweet onion, chopped
  • 2 celery stalks, thinly sliced
  • 2 carrots, sliced into thin half-moons
  • 1 clove garlic
  • salt
  • 3 tablespoons all-purpose flour
  • 6 cups chicken broth
  • 2 bay leaves
  • 1 teaspoon Worcestershire sauce
  • 1/2 teaspoon Tasbasco sauce
  • 8 ounces uncooked egg noodles
  • 1 cup half-and-half
  • 1 cup frozen peas, defrosted
  • 3 cups cooked, I use rotisserie chicken, shredded chicken
  • 1 tablespoon chopped fresh dill
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per

Instructions

  • Melt butter over medium heat in a Dutch oven or large pot.
  • Add onion, celery, and carrots and cook until soft, about 5 minutes.
  • Add garlic and cook 1 minute. Season with salt.
  • Sprinkle flour over veggies and stir and cook for 1 to 2 minutes.
  • Gradually stir in chicken broth. Add bay leaves, Worcestershire sauce, and Tabasco.
  • Bring to a simmer and simmer for 10 minutes, stirring occasionally.
  • Add egg noodles and cook 5 minutes.
  • Stir in half-and-half, chicken, and peas and continue to cook just until noodles are cooked through, about 5 more minutes.
  • Stir in pepper and dill and serve.

      Half-and-Half is a product you can find in any American store. If you are in another country you won’t find it. But no worries. All it is is equal parts heavy cream and milk.
